Demographics
According to the 2011 census, the taluk of Ulundurpet had a population of 369,357 with 186,410 males and 182,947 females. There were 981 women for every 1000 men. The taluk had a literacy rate of 60.38. Child population in the age group below 6 was 23,270 Males and 21,734 Females.
